issues
search
soasme
/
PeppaPEG
PEG Parser in ANSI C
https://soasme.com/PeppaPEG
MIT License
55
stars
7
forks
source link
issues
Newest
Newest
Most commented
Recently updated
Oldest
Least commented
Least recently updated
Shell: rename as `--grammar-str` to avoid ambiguous option.
#104
soasme
closed
3 years ago
0
Improve Literal Spec Test
#103
soasme
closed
3 years ago
0
Add Shell Subcommand: peppa ast.
#102
soasme
closed
3 years ago
0
Feature: utility peppa
#101
soasme
closed
3 years ago
0
CMake: add new command `make install`.
#100
soasme
closed
3 years ago
0
Support Unicode Property & General Category
#99
soasme
closed
3 years ago
0
Example: Toml AST
#98
soasme
closed
3 years ago
0
Performance Improvement: Less Call Frames During Recursion.
#97
soasme
closed
3 years ago
0
peg: set insensitive for back reference rule.
#96
soasme
closed
3 years ago
0
PEG: Back Reference
#95
soasme
closed
3 years ago
0
Enhance Error Message
#94
soasme
closed
3 years ago
0
Enhance Error Message
#93
soasme
closed
3 years ago
0
match: expand catch_err to accept an additional callback.
#92
soasme
closed
3 years ago
0
Code Improvement: Report Lineno:Offset to P4_MatchRaisef()
#91
soasme
closed
3 years ago
0
New Kind: Cut
#90
soasme
closed
3 years ago
0
API: remove param grammar from P4_GetGrammarRule.
#89
soasme
closed
3 years ago
0
impl: wrap errors with catch_err & catch_oom.
#88
soasme
closed
3 years ago
0
bugfix: stop line/offset should handle eof after for-loop.
#87
soasme
closed
3 years ago
0
Documentation improvements
#86
soasme
closed
3 years ago
0
Sanitizer
#85
soasme
closed
3 years ago
0
Use P4_String for Referencing Rules
#84
soasme
closed
3 years ago
0
Example: Toml
#83
soasme
closed
3 years ago
0
Hide struct
#82
soasme
closed
3 years ago
0
Example: add toml parser
#81
soasme
closed
3 years ago
0
peg: support \xXX
#80
soasme
closed
3 years ago
0
PEG: use \uXXXX or \UXXXXXXXX for unicode code points
#79
soasme
closed
3 years ago
0
Rename Token to Node
#78
soasme
closed
3 years ago
0
[Feature Request] Support Unicode Category ID_Start, Other_ID_Start, ID_Continue, Other_ID_Continue
#77
soasme
closed
3 years ago
1
[Feature Request] Optional Unicode Category
#76
soasme
closed
3 years ago
1
[Enhancement] Improve Error Reporting.
#75
soasme
closed
3 years ago
0
[Enhancement] Report Error Messages for Human.
#74
soasme
closed
3 years ago
0
[Enhancement] Panic if LoadGrammar fails
#73
soasme
closed
3 years ago
0
[Enhancement] Report Errors When Failed to Load Grammar.
#72
soasme
closed
3 years ago
0
[Enhancement] Report error message if failed to load grammar.
#71
soasme
closed
3 years ago
0
[Enhancement] Mark UNREACHABLE for some switch cases.
#70
soasme
closed
3 years ago
0
[Feature]: Comment
#69
soasme
closed
3 years ago
0
[Example] Write a DOT parser using Peppa PEG.
#68
soasme
closed
3 years ago
0
[Feature]: Support Unicode Character Categories for P4_Range.
#67
soasme
closed
3 years ago
0
[Feature]: Allow arbitrary number of @spaces rules.
#66
soasme
closed
3 years ago
0
[Feature Request]: Unicode Range
#65
soasme
closed
3 years ago
0
[Feature]: Acquire Source AST
#64
soasme
closed
3 years ago
0
[Docs] add tutjson page
#63
soasme
closed
3 years ago
0
[Feature] Add P4_ResetSource.
#62
soasme
closed
3 years ago
0
[Feature]: Add P4_InspectSourceAst.
#61
soasme
closed
3 years ago
0
[Feature]: Customize malloc/free/realloc.
#60
soasme
closed
3 years ago
0
[Feature]: Dot
#59
soasme
closed
3 years ago
0
Example: Load Json Grammar Using PEG API.
#58
soasme
closed
3 years ago
0
Jsonify need grammar
#57
soasme
closed
3 years ago
0
[Feature]: Load Peg Grammar
#56
soasme
closed
3 years ago
0
[Test] Enable Valgrind if built with GCC.
#55
soasme
closed
3 years ago
0
Previous
Next